Literature summary for 1.3.8.1 extracted from

  • Jethva, R.; Bennett, M.J.; Vockley, J.
    Short-chain acyl-coenzyme A dehydrogenase deficiency (2008), Mol. Genet. Metab., 95, 195-200.
    View publication on PubMedView publication on EuropePMC

Application

Application Comment Organism
medicine short-chain acyl-coenzyme A dehydrogenase deficiency is attributed to alterations in the SCAD gene Homo sapiens

Protein Variants

Protein Variants Comment Organism
G185S 625G>A polymorphism Homo sapiens
R147W 511C>T polymorphism Homo sapiens
